Total Energy Services Inc. Announces 2022 First Quarter Conference Call and Webcast

CALGARY, Alberta, April 06,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Total Energy Services Inc. (“Total Energy”) (TSX:TOT) will conduct a conference call and webcast following the release of its financial results for the three months ended March 31, 2022. The financial results will be released prior to the conference call. Daniel Halyk, President and CEO will host the call.

Headquartered in Calgary, Alberta, Total Energy provides contract drilling services, equipment rentals and transportation services, well servicing and compression and process equipment and service to the energy and other resource industries from operation centers in North America and Australia. The common shares of Total Energy are listed and trade on the TSX under the symbol “TOT”.
